  • mannie graymannie gray Posts: 7,259 ✭✭✭✭✭

    Well then, it's either FS-101 (die 1 as I said) or FS-103 (die 3).
    It's not 105 (die 5).
    And actually both the dies it may be are scarcer than the quite common FS-105.

  • AzurescensAzurescens Posts: 2,769 ✭✭✭✭✭

    @micromayfly said:
    sorry not the best
    I'm holding my ipad in front of scope
    kinda difficult!

    Set the coin down. Bring your eye and loop down to the coin. If you don't have steady hands, rest your loop on something that you can raise or lower the height. Playing cards work best. Then bring the mag on your cam to max and, without touching the loop, get the best shot you can without glare from your lamp. Hope this helps!
